AI Summary

  • Prohibits the use of electronic devices to check in voters at polling places, effectively banning electronic poll books/lists

  • Eliminates the countywide polling place program (Section 43.007), which currently allows voters to cast ballots at any polling location within their county rather than an assigned precinct location

  • Requires commissioners courts to assign early voters to specific early voting polling places within their commissioners precinct, rather than allowing voting at any early voting location

  • Reduces the maximum number of student election clerks permitted at any polling place from four (previously allowed at countywide polling places) to two

  • Repeals eight provisions of the Election Code related to countywide polling places and electronic poll list requirements

  • Takes effect September 1, 2025

Legislative Description

Relating to the elimination of electronic poll lists and the countywide polling place program.
